A2ZINFRA vs TEXINFRA: Stock Comparison
A2Z Infra Engineering Limited vs Texmaco Infrastructure & Holdings Limited
Live data: 24 July 2026, 4:08 PM IST • Source: NSE and company filings
Texmaco Infrastructure & Holdings Limited is the larger company by market capitalisation. A2Z Infra Engineering Limited shows a lower P/E, a higher ROE and lower leverage, while Texmaco Infrastructure & Holdings Limited shows a higher dividend yield, faster revenue growth and a higher net margin. Valuation
| Metric | A2ZINFRA | TEXINFRA |
|---|---|---|
| Market Cap | ₹221 Cr | ₹1,437 Cr |
| P/E Ratio | 100.36x | 130.12x |
| P/B Ratio | 5.6x | 1.34x |
| EPS | ₹0.25 | ₹0.86 |
| Book Value | ₹3.16 | ₹87.9 |
| Dividend Yield | 0% | 0.13% |
Growth
| Metric | A2ZINFRA | TEXINFRA |
|---|---|---|
| Revenue Growth (TTM YoY) | 28.9% | 31.1% |
| EPS Growth (TTM YoY) | 0% | -52.3% |
| Qtr Sales Growth | 28.9% | 31.2% |
| Qtr Profit Growth | 522% | -46% |
Profitability & Leverage
| Metric | A2ZINFRA | TEXINFRA |
|---|---|---|
| ROE | 28.9% | 0.93% |
| ROCE | 13.8% | 1.45% |
| Net Margin | 0.62% | 62.6% |
| Operating Margin | 5.44% | -40.86% |
| Debt to Equity | 2.07x | 2.63x |
